oil consumption due to.....
Greetings from an oil burner. I was watching some vids from Hrspwr Freaks where a 1k HP S54 was built. The engine builder commented that BMW engines he has seen show oil consumption becauuse BMW doesn't use a Torque Plate when honing the cylinders.
Just wanted to throw this out. |

High performance engines burn oil for a variety of reasons, but the main ones are loose tolerances in the engine and low tension rings.
No torque plate infers that the cylinders are out of round and that BMW cheaped out on their most important engines. Like I said above. The engine builder is an idiot.
